#311b3c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#311b3c is composed of 19.2% red, 10.6%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.3% cyan, 55%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 280 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 17.1%. #311b3c color hex could be obtained by blending #623678 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#311b3c color description : Very dark desaturated violet.

#311b3c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#311b3c has RGB values of R:49, G:27,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 3218236.

Shades and Tints of #311b3c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050306 is the darkest color, while #faf7fc is the lightest one.
